Zemskov V. N. The great turning point. The true scale of Stalin’s purges. Moscow: Prospekt, 2022. 760 p.: Book review

Abstract

The peer-reviewed publication covers a wide range of issues related to the political purges in the USSR in the 1930s-1950s. The work also contains research on the role of the working class in resisting the German fascists on Soviet territory during the Great Patriotic War. The monograph will be necessary for anyone who studies the history of the development of Soviet society in the 1930s-1950s.
